Shopping
In Crickhowell, you'll find charming local shops along the high street offering unique g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, visit Abergavenny's Market Hall, around 11.3km away, where you can explore an array of local produce, crafts, and delightful food stalls.
Recreation
Crickhowell's Green Retreat offers tranquil yoga classes amidst stunning mountain views, promoting mindfulness and relaxation. Explore the nearby Brecon Beacons National Park for invigorating hikes and breathtaking scenery, perfect for rejuvenating both body and mind.
Adventure
Explore the breathtaking Brecon Beacons National Park, perfect for hiking, rock climbing, and mountain biking. Experience the thrill of canoeing on the River Usk, or take a guided caving adventure in the dramatic limestone caves nearby. Each activity promises stunning scenery and unforgettable memories.
